Abstract

The utility model relates to a hand-driven type inflator, comprising cams, a handle, a barrel body, a connecting rod, a piston, a gas pipe, a gas outlet gripping head, wherein the upper cam and the lower cam are respectively mounted on a left bracket and a right bracket, and can rotate along a rotation axle; the handle is mounted on the upper cam; the inner part of the barrel body is hollow; one end of the connecting rod is connected with the lower cam, the other end of the connecting rod is connected with the piston and the connecting rod is driven by the lower cam to perform the vertical back-and-forth movement; the piston is arranged in the barrel body and connected with the connecting rod to make linear movement in the vertical direction in the barrel body; the gas pipe is mounted on a base seat and communicated with the inner part of the barrel body; and the gas outlet gripping head is mounted on the tail end of the gas pipe and during the inflation process, and the gas outlet gripping head is connected with a tire valve core. According to the utility model, the circular movement is converted into the linear movement by the two cams and one slider-crank mechanism, the inflation process is easily accomplished by the user in the sitting or other comfortable postures without repeated stooping actions which consume great amount of strength, the operation is simple, the structure is novel, and the carrying is convenient.

In Fig. 1, first embodiment shown in Figure 2, a kind of shaking type pump is characterized in that: it is made up of cam, handle, stack shell, connecting rod, piston, tracheae, the chuck of giving vent to anger; Described cam has two, divides overhead cam and following cam, on two supports, can rotate around the axis about being installed in respectively; Described handle is installed on the overhead cam; Described stack shell is cylindric, inner hollow; Described connecting rod one end is connected with following cam, and an end is connected with piston, can do motion up and down by following cam driven; Described piston is inner at stack shell, is being connected by connecting rod and in tube, is doing straight line motion up and down; Described tracheae is installed on the base, is connected with stack shell inside; The described chuck of giving vent to anger is installed in the end of tracheae, is connected with tyre valve core during inflation.
In second embodiment shown in Figure 2; Shake handle and rotate overhead cam, following cam also rotates thereupon, and does straight line motion up and down reciprocatingly through connecting rod drive piston in stack shell inside; Air is pressed into from tracheae in the tire that is connected the chuck of giving vent to anger, accomplishes gas replenishment process.
